Thomasville's hottest and coldest months
Thomasville's hottest month is Aug, averaging 81°F; its coldest is Jan, averaging 50°F, a 31°F swing across the year, a middling gap by national standards.
Rain and snow in Thomasville
Thomasville averages 50.94in of precipitation a year across roughly 90 days with measurable rain or snow, and 0in of snow a year.
